Understanding the Performance Bottlenecks

To optimize your React Native app’s performance, it’s essential to recognize where bottlenecks often occur. Some common performance issues include:

  1. Large JavaScript Bundles: Large bundles can cause slow initial loading times.
  2. Unoptimized Images and Assets: High-resolution images can take time to download and render.
  3. Excessive Renders: Components that render too frequently or unnecessarily can hinder performance.
  4. Memory Leaks: Poorly managed resources can lead to sluggishness over time as your app continues to run.
  5. Slow Animations: Apps that incorporate animations require careful attention to ensure smooth transitions.

1. Optimize Your JavaScript Bundle

One of the first steps toward improving performance is to optimize your JavaScript bundle. This can be achieved through:

  • Code Splitting: Only load the parts of the app required for the initial render. Features that aren’t necessary until later can be loaded asynchronously.
  • Using the Production Build: Make sure you are using the production build of React Native, which minifies and optimizes your code.

2. Efficient Image Handling

Images are often the largest assets in your application, so they can significantly impact performance. Here’s how you can handle images more effectively:

  • Resolution and Format: Choose the appropriate resolutions and formats for images. Utilizing SVGs for icons and simple graphics can reduce load times.
  • Caching: Use libraries like react-native-fast-image to efficiently cache images, minimizing redundant network requests and speeding up load times.

3. Prevent Unnecessary Re-renders

Every unnecessary re-render can lead to performance degradation. To mitigate this, you can:

  • Use Memoization: React’s useMemo and memo can prevent unnecessary re-renders of functional and class components.
  • Optimize FlatList: When using FlatList, ensure that you provide proper key extraction and render item props to prevent re-renders.

4. Manage Navigation Efficiently

Navigation can heavily impact an app’s performance. To optimize navigation:

  • Use React Navigation Efficiently: Manage navigation state intelligently by leveraging lazy loading for screens that are rarely visited.
  • Focus on Deep Links: Implementing deep linking can help direct users to specific areas of the app without extensive re-navigation processes.

5. Optimize Animation Performance

Animations can add character to your app, but they should not hinder performance. Here’s how you can ensure your animations are smooth:

  • Use the Native Driver: Leverage React Native’s Animated API with the useNativeDriver option to run animations on the native thread.

javascript
Animated.timing(this.state.animatedValue, {
toValue: 1,
duration: 500,
useNativeDriver: true, // This improves performance
}).start();

6. Debugging and Profiling

To identify performance bottlenecks, leverage tools such as:

  • React DevTools: This allows you to profile components and helps identify unnecessary renders.
  • Flipper: A platform for debugging mobile apps that offers great tools for React Native developers.

These tools can help you pinpoint performance issues and give insights into how your app behaves during operation.

7. Performance Monitoring

Once your app is deployed, continuous performance monitoring is essential. Tools like Firebase Performance Monitoring can help you keep track of your app’s health post-launch. You can also implement custom logging to track specific events and their performance impact.

8. Keep Dependencies Updated

Keeping your libraries and dependencies updated ensures that you are utilizing the latest optimizations and bug fixes. However, it’s essential to test thoroughly after updating to prevent any unforeseen issues.

9. Use Background Threads

Heavy computations can be offloaded to background threads, ensuring that the main thread remains responsive. Libraries like react-native-worker can enable you to run JavaScript tasks in the background.

10. Offload Heavy Computations

When performing complex calculations, consider delegating intensive tasks to a server or using native modules for better performance. You can also evaluate whether you need to perform these tasks on the client-side or if they can be handled elsewhere.
